Elegant and Spacious Double Upper House (173 m²) with Roof Terrace (47 m²) and Private Entrance. An elegant and generous double upper house of 173 m² with a spacious 47 m² roof terrace and a private entrance from the street. The property is freehold and located in the prestigious Oud-Zuid district, near Cornelis Schuytstraat and within walking distance of Vondelpark and Museumplein. Spread over two full floors, the home offers a spacious en-suite living area, a modern kitchen, four bedrooms, and a large bathroom. Authentic details are found throughout, and the combination of these with modern comforts makes this property a truly exceptional residence on one of Amsterdam’s most desirable streets. From the roof terrace, panoramic views stretch across the Conservatorium Hotel, the Obrechtkerk, and Leidseplein. Layout Via the carpeted staircase, you reach the second floor, where the welcoming hallway—with separate toilet—gives access to all rooms. At the front is the charming living room with tall windows, an original mantelpiece, and French doors opening onto a sunny balcony. Through en-suite sliding doors, the dining room is accessed (also directly from the hallway). This connects to the semi-open kitchen. French doors at the rear lead to a second balcony overlooking the green inner gardens. High ceilings with ornate moldings enhance the classic character of this floor. The modern kitchen is finished in white with an anthracite natural stone countertop and equipped with built-in appliances, including an elevated dishwasher, a six-burner gas stove, a large fridge with separate freezer, and a Miele oven. Handleless cabinets and drawers provide ample storage space. The kitchen floor features large sand-colored tiles. Also on this floor is a versatile study/guest bedroom at the front. A classic wooden staircase leads to the top floor, where three full-sized bedrooms are located—two at the front, and the primary bedroom at the rear with access to its own balcony. Two bedrooms feature private washbasins. The spacious bathroom combines anthracite floor tiles with anthracite and off-white wall tiles and offers a walk-in shower, bathtub, and a double-sink vanity. On the landing, there is a laundry area with washing machine connection and a separate toilet. Beneath the floating wooden staircase, a practical storage space has been created, including a custom-built workstation. This striking staircase leads to the highlight of the home: the generous 47 m² roof terrace. The rooftop structure has French doors on two sides, opening to the sun-drenched terrace with breathtaking city views, including the Conservatorium Hotel, Leidseplein, and the Obrechtkerk. The apartment features oak flooring throughout most areas, high ceilings, abundant windows, and multiple outdoor spaces. The location is ideal: just steps from Vondelpark, the Concertgebouw, and the Cornelis Schuytstraat with its exclusive shops, coffee bars, and restaurants. Here you’ll experience the perfect balance of vibrant city life and tranquility. Location & Accessibility The property is located in highly sought-after Amsterdam Oud-Zuid, between Banstraat and Cornelis Schuytstraat. Valeriusstraat has a charming, almost village-like atmosphere. The famous Vondelpark is within walking distance, as is the Museum Quarter with the Concertgebouw. Daily groceries and specialty shops are nearby on Beethovenstraat, Van Baerlestraat, Cornelis Schuytstraat, or Amstelveenseweg. For luxury shopping, the Cornelis Schuytstraat, P.C. Hooftstraat, and Beethovenstraat are close at hand. The area also offers a wide range of cafés, terraces, and restaurants. Well-regarded schools and public transport (trams and buses) are all within walking distance, while main roads can be reached within minutes. Parking Paid parking applies on the public street under a permit system. According to the City of Amsterdam’s website, there is currently a waiting list for parking permits (as of 9 April 2025, permit area Zuid 8.1). NEN Clause The stated living area has been measured in accordance with the NEN 2580 standard. The result may differ from comparable properties or older references due to this (newer) calculation method. Buyers acknowledge having been adequately informed about this standard. The seller and broker have done their utmost to calculate the correct area and support this with floorplans. Should the actual measurements differ, buyers accept this. Buyers have been given ample opportunity to verify measurements independently. Any difference in stated size gives neither party grounds for claim or adjustment of the purchase price.
